Actually, if you have Mac OsX Server, you can virtualize Os X Desktop. How? Using Time Machine.

 

I've never did it, but:

 

- Install Mac OsX Server.

 

- Make a Time Machine backup of your host system or any Os X system.

 

- Share the location of the ackup with the VM.

 

- Boot your Virtual Machine on the installation disc.

 

- From the disc, choose the option restore the system from a Time Machine backup.

 

- And roll.

 

 

 

If your using a hackintosh backup, beware of your eventual modified kext :) .
